Transaction 78f1a7f34d1105b954582c0a271e7858e754594cc140250296863a0128040eba
1 Input
1 Output
-
78f1a7f34d1105b954582c0a271e7858e754594cc140250296863a0128040eba:0
- value
- 16076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 855b57eb10aaffc42e111836d334b6fe38523739 OP_EQUAL
- address
- 3Dr9Di8kuza4MJcp3URqp2H3EWF52BN7kb